PR build/34279 reports a build failure with clang.

This is a regression since commit 6c85ef111b0 ("[gdb] Use using instead of
typedef"), which did:
...
-typedef long __attribute__ ((__aligned__ (4))) compat_x32_clock_t;
+using compat_x32_clock_t = long __attribute__ ((__aligned__ (4)));
...

The problem is that clang ignores the attribute.

Fix this by reverting this part of the commit.

FYI, this form:

  using B [[gnu::aligned (4)]] = long;

works the same with gcc and clang.

I ended up using a suggestion of Pedro ( 
https://sourceware.org/pipermail/gdb-patches/2026-June/228041.html ):
...
-typedef long __attribute__ ((__aligned__ (4))) compat_x32_clock_t;
+using compat_x32_clock_t [[gnu::aligned (4)]] = long;
...
so I guess such a comment is not needed.
